Standard Input-Output Norms require imported inputs to match the declared export product under SION compliance, ensuring admissible use and verification. Standard Input-Output Norms under the Foreign Trade Policy are implemented via SION entries for chemical products; applicants must ensure imported inputs correspond to the goods actually used or required for the declared export product, and administrative compliance requires verification that imported materials match SION-prescribed inputs and proportions.
